 #ifndef ZEND_CFG_H
 #define ZEND_CFG_H
 
 /* zend_basic_block.flags */
 #define ZEND_BB_START            (1<<0)  /* first block            */
 #define ZEND_BB_FOLLOW           (1<<1)  /* follows the next block */
 #define ZEND_BB_TARGET           (1<<2)  /* jump target            */
 #define ZEND_BB_EXIT             (1<<3)  /* without successors     */
 #define ZEND_BB_ENTRY            (1<<4)  /* stackless entry        */
 #define ZEND_BB_TRY              (1<<5)  /* start of try block     */
 #define ZEND_BB_CATCH            (1<<6)  /* start of catch block   */
 #define ZEND_BB_FINALLY          (1<<7)  /* start of finally block */
 #define ZEND_BB_FINALLY_END      (1<<8)  /* end of finally block   */
 #define ZEND_BB_UNREACHABLE_FREE (1<<11) /* unreachable loop free  */
 #define ZEND_BB_RECV_ENTRY       (1<<12) /* RECV entry             */
 
 #define ZEND_BB_LOOP_HEADER      (1<<16)
 #define ZEND_BB_IRREDUCIBLE_LOOP (1<<17)
 
 #define ZEND_BB_REACHABLE        (1U<<31)
 
 #define ZEND_BB_PROTECTED        (ZEND_BB_ENTRY|ZEND_BB_RECV_ENTRY|ZEND_BB_TRY|ZEND_BB_CATCH|ZEND_BB_FINALLY|ZEND_BB_FINALLY_END|ZEND_BB_UNREACHABLE_FREE)
 
 typedef struct _zend_basic_block {
 int              *successors;         /* successor block indices     */
 uint32_t          flags;
 uint32_t          start;              /* first opcode number         */
 uint32_t          len;                /* number of opcodes           */
 int               successors_count;   /* number of successors        */
 int               predecessors_count; /* number of predecessors      */
 int               predecessor_offset; /* offset of 1-st predecessor  */
 int               idom;               /* immediate dominator block   */
 int               loop_header;        /* closest loop header, or -1  */
 int               level;              /* steps away from the entry in the dom. tree */
 int               children;           /* list of dominated blocks    */
 int               next_child;         /* next dominated block        */
 int               successors_storage[2]; /* up to 2 successor blocks */
 } zend_basic_block;
 
 /*
 +------------+---+---+---+---+---+
 |            |OP1|OP2|EXT| 0 | 1 |
 +------------+---+---+---+---+---+
 |JMP         |ADR|   |   |OP1| - |
 |JMPZ        |   |ADR|   |OP2|FOL|
 |JMPNZ       |   |ADR|   |OP2|FOL|
 |JMPZNZ      |   |ADR|ADR|OP2|EXT|
 |JMPZ_EX     |   |ADR|   |OP2|FOL|
 |JMPNZ_EX    |   |ADR|   |OP2|FOL|
 |JMP_SET     |   |ADR|   |OP2|FOL|
 |COALESCE    |   |ADR|   |OP2|FOL|
 |ASSERT_CHK  |   |ADR|   |OP2|FOL|
 |NEW         |   |ADR|   |OP2|FOL|
 |DCL_ANON*   |ADR|   |   |OP1|FOL|
 |FE_RESET_*  |   |ADR|   |OP2|FOL|
 |FE_FETCH_*  |   |   |ADR|EXT|FOL|
 |CATCH       |   |   |ADR|EXT|FOL|
 |FAST_CALL   |ADR|   |   |OP1|FOL|
 |FAST_RET    |   |   |   | - | - |
 |RETURN*     |   |   |   | - | - |
 |EXIT        |   |   |   | - | - |
 |THROW       |   |   |   | - | - |
 |*           |   |   |   |FOL| - |
 +------------+---+---+---+---+---+
 */
 
 typedef struct _zend_cfg {
 int               blocks_count;       /* number of basic blocks      */
 int               edges_count;        /* number of edges             */
 zend_basic_block *blocks;             /* array of basic blocks       */
 int              *predecessors;
 uint32_t         *map;
 uint32_t          flags;
 } zend_cfg;
 
 /* Build Flags */
 #define ZEND_CFG_STACKLESS             (1<<30)
 #define ZEND_SSA_DEBUG_LIVENESS        (1<<29)
 #define ZEND_SSA_DEBUG_PHI_PLACEMENT   (1<<28)
 #define ZEND_SSA_RC_INFERENCE          (1<<27)
 #define ZEND_CFG_NO_ENTRY_PREDECESSORS (1<<25)
 #define ZEND_CFG_RECV_ENTRY            (1<<24)
 #define ZEND_CALL_TREE                 (1<<23)
 #define ZEND_SSA_USE_CV_RESULTS        (1<<22)
 
 #define CRT_CONSTANT_EX(op_array, opline, node) \
 (((op_array)->fn_flags & ZEND_ACC_DONE_PASS_TWO) ? \
 RT_CONSTANT(opline, (node)) \
 : \
 CT_CONSTANT_EX(op_array, (node).constant) \
 )
 
 #define CRT_CONSTANT(node) \
 CRT_CONSTANT_EX(op_array, opline, node)
 
 #define RETURN_VALUE_USED(opline) \
 ((opline)->result_type != IS_UNUSED)
 
 BEGIN_EXTERN_C()
 
 ZEND_API int zend_build_cfg(zend_arena **arena, const zend_op_array *op_array, uint32_t build_flags, zend_cfg *cfg);
 void zend_cfg_remark_reachable_blocks(const zend_op_array *op_array, zend_cfg *cfg);
 ZEND_API int zend_cfg_build_predecessors(zend_arena **arena, zend_cfg *cfg);
 ZEND_API int zend_cfg_compute_dominators_tree(const zend_op_array *op_array, zend_cfg *cfg);
 ZEND_API int zend_cfg_identify_loops(const zend_op_array *op_array, zend_cfg *cfg);
 
 END_EXTERN_C()
 
 #endif /* ZEND_CFG_H */
